aboutsummaryrefslogtreecommitdiff
path: root/timeline.ts
diff options
context:
space:
mode:
authorlonkaars <loek@pipeframe.xyz>2021-05-09 16:59:23 +0200
committerlonkaars <loek@pipeframe.xyz>2021-05-09 16:59:23 +0200
commit5a0f2ed7af3bb804219c1be07969103572384ceb (patch)
treebb87a04560201d8af6e6e4ca5d84f8a06b8c3ace /timeline.ts
parent87f7bd7b20277786c39726db397caf1971abb956 (diff)
add next.js project files
Diffstat (limited to 'timeline.ts')
-rw-r--r--timeline.ts21
1 files changed, 10 insertions, 11 deletions
diff --git a/timeline.ts b/timeline.ts
index 0f1137e..fb60cf5 100644
--- a/timeline.ts
+++ b/timeline.ts
@@ -1,25 +1,24 @@
interface slide {
- frame: number
- clickThroughBehaviour: "ImmediatelySkip" | "PlayOut"
- type: "default" | "delay" | "speedChange" | "loop"
+ frame: number;
+ clickThroughBehaviour: 'ImmediatelySkip' | 'PlayOut';
+ type: 'default' | 'delay' | 'speedChange' | 'loop';
}
interface delaySlide extends slide {
- delay: number
+ delay: number;
}
interface speedChangeSlide extends slide {
- newFramerate: number
+ newFramerate: number;
}
interface loopSlide extends slide {
- endFrame: number
- playbackType: "PingPong" | "Normal"
+ endFrame: number;
+ playbackType: 'PingPong' | 'Normal';
}
interface timeline {
- slides: slide[]
- framecount: number
- framerate: number
+ slides: slide[];
+ framecount: number;
+ framerate: number;
}
-